          Abstract

          Este artículo tiene como sustento teórico a la psicología de la salud, en general, y a la psicología de la salud infantil, en particular. La línea de investigación en la cual se enmarca es la de enfermedades crónicas, abordadas desde una perspectiva biopsicosocial. Se dan a conocer datos que demuestran la eficacia de las intervenciones psicológicas a nivel hospitalario. En esta investigación se muestra que los programas holísticos fomentan la calidad de vida del paciente pediátrico con leucemia. La razón fundamental para abordar esta neoplasia es porque es la más frecuente en la población pediátrica a nivel mundial y porque existen pocos programas de apoyo de orden psicológico para estos niños y sus familias. La creciente investigación en el área representa la posibilidad de incidir en diferentes instituciones logrando la inclusión del psicólogo y demostrando que una intervención multidisciplinaria es la opción más acertada.

          Translated abstract

          This article has a general theoretical support on health psychology, but it focuses on child health psychology. The line of research focuses chronic illnesses from a biopsychosocial perspective. There is data that demonstrates the effectiveness of psychological interventions in hospitals. This research shows that holistic programs foment the quality of life on pediatric patients with leukemia. Approaching leukemia is essential because it is the most frequent disease in the pediatric population and psychological programs to support these children and their families are few. Increasing research in this area represents the impact and possibilities of holistic programs in different institutions by including psychological programs and demonstrating that multidisciplinary intervention is the best option.

          Stress, Appraisal, and Coping

          <p><b>The reissue of a classic work, now with a foreword by Daniel Goleman!</b><p>Here is a monumental work that continues in the tradition pioneered by co-author Richard Lazarus in his classic book <i>Psychological Stress and the Coping Process</i>. Dr. Lazarus and his collaborator, Dr. Susan Folkman, present here a detailed theory of psychological stress, building on the concepts of cognitive appraisal and coping which have become major themes of theory and investigation.</p> <p>As an integrative theoretical analysis, this volume pulls together two decades of research and thought on issues in behavioral medicine, emotion, stress management, treatment, and life span development. A selective review of the most pertinent literature is included in each chapter. The total reference listing for the book extends to 60 pages.</p> <p>This work is necessarily multidisciplinary, reflecting the many dimensions of stress-related problems and their situation within a complex social context. While the emphasis is on psychological aspects of stress, the book is oriented towards professionals in various disciplines, as well as advanced students and educated laypersons. The intended audience ranges from psychiatrists, clinical psychologists, nurses, and social workers to sociologists, anthropologists, medical researchers, and physiologists.</p>
